Praxis, a "cyber state" project, raises $525 million, with Farcaster CEO, Worldcoin co-founder and others participating
10-16 00:30
Odaily News The "Network State" project Praxis announced on Tuesday that it had raised $525 million in financing, with participation from angel investors such as Arch Lending, Manifold Trading, Farcaster CEO Dan Romero and Worldcoin co-founder Max Novendstern. The project had previously received financing from Paradigm, Alameda Research and Three Arrows Capital. The new funds will be used to build a city at the forefront of technology to support the development of cryptocurrency, artificial intelligence, energy and biotechnology. A report published in the Wall Street Journal stated that the location of the future Praxis city has not yet been determined. The project's website also shows that the project has nearly 14,000 "Praxians" who live all over the world. (The Block)
